#600cce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#600cce is composed of 37.6% red, 4.7% green and 80.8%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 53.4% cyan, 94.2% magenta, 0% yellow and 19.2% black. It has a hue angle of 266 degrees, a saturation of 89% and a lightness of 42.7%. #600cce color hex could be obtained by blending #c018ff with #00009d. Closest websafe color is: #6600cc.

Shades and Tints of #600cce
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#010002 is the darkest color, while #f5effe is the lightest one.

Tones of #600cce
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#6c6872 is the less saturated color, while #5f04d6 is the most saturated one.
